Volkswagen increases stake in Scania

Volkswagen AG increased its stake in Scania AB from 18.7 percent to 20.03 percent on March 6, 2007; this represents a 35.31 percent of the voting rights in Scania (previously 34 percent).

 

The step underlines the importance Volkswagen attaches to its participation in Scania. The hareholdings in MAN and Scania aim to safeguard the strategic interest of the Group in the commercial vehicles business and are adequate for finding a friendly and mutually agreeable solution to realize the acknowledged high synergies. In this context, Volkswagen also recently increased its stake in MAN to 29.9 percent.
